As easy as it will be for him to do the exercises with free weights, with machines it will start to be a headache. Fortunately, steve's years of bodybuilding experience have made it easy for him to overcome these difficulties, as he's already developed these habits.

Everyone has different proportions in relation to their size, with shorter or shorter muscles, different segments. A tall person will not train with the same amplitude as a short person. For the same result and good symmetry, a tall person will need more effort, more work.
